Solocof D Syrup Sugar Free 100ml

Solocof D Syrup Sugar Free 100ml is a prescription combination medicine containing three active ingredients: Chlorpheniramine Maleate, Dextromethorphan, and Phenylephrine. Chlorpheniramine is a first-generation antihistamine that relieves allergy-related symptoms such as sneezing and a runny nose. Dextromethorphan is a cough suppressant that reduces the tendency to cough by acting on the cough centre in the brain. Phenylephrine constricts blood vessels in the nasal passages, helping to reduce swelling and relieve nasal congestion. The sugar-free (SF) base makes it suitable for patients who need to limit sugar intake. Together, these components provide comprehensive relief from dry cough and upper respiratory symptoms associated with the common cold, allergic rhinitis, and related conditions when taken as advised by a physician.

Detailed Description

Solocof D Syrup Sugar Free 100ml contains three active ingredients: Chlorpheniramine Maleate, Dextromethorphan, and Phenylephrine, each contributing a specific therapeutic action in the management of cough and cold.

Composition and Mechanism: Solocof D Syrup Sugar Free 100ml contains Chlorpheniramine Maleate, a first-generation antihistamine that blocks H1 histamine receptors, reducing symptoms such as sneezing, runny nose, itching, and watery eyes. Dextromethorphan is a centrally acting, non-opioid antitussive that suppresses the cough reflex by acting on the cough centre in the brain. Phenylephrine is a sympathomimetic agent that stimulates alpha-1 adrenergic receptors, causing vasoconstriction in nasal blood vessels and relieving nasal congestion.

Major Therapeutic Uses: Solocof D Syrup Sugar Free 100ml is primarily indicated for the symptomatic relief of dry cough, common cold, and allergic rhinitis. It helps reduce coughing, sneezing, throat irritation, and nasal blockage, and is beneficial in conditions associated with post-nasal drip.

Benefits and Precautions: This combination provides a multi-targeted approach by controlling allergic symptoms, suppressing cough, and relieving nasal congestion. However, Chlorpheniramine may cause drowsiness, while Phenylephrine may increase blood pressure or heart rate. Use with caution in patients with hypertension, heart disease, glaucoma, or prostate enlargement.

Medical Supervision and Risks: This medicine should be used under medical supervision, especially in children and elderly patients. Avoid use with MAO inhibitors due to the risk of severe hypertension. Monitor for excessive sedation, restlessness, or cardiovascular effects. Prolonged or inappropriate use should be avoided.

Uses of Solocof D Syrup Sugar Free 100ml

Solocof D Syrup Sugar Free 100ml is indicated by a doctor for:

Relief from Dry Cough

Provides symptomatic relief of non-productive (dry) cough caused by the common cold, flu, or other upper respiratory tract infections.

Allergic Rhinitis with Cough

Helps manage cough along with allergy symptoms such as sneezing, runny nose, nasal itching, and watery eyes.

Post-nasal Drip-Induced Cough

Relieves cough caused by post-nasal drip associated with allergic or infective rhinitis.

Benefits of Solocof D Syrup Sugar Free 100ml

  • Improved Respiratory Airflow: The decongestant effect of Phenylephrine opens narrowed airways, making breathing significantly easier.
  • Improves Sleep Quality: By reducing cough and allergic symptoms, and with the mild sedative effect of Chlorpheniramine, it helps promote restful sleep at night.
  • Non-Opioid Cough Suppression: Dextromethorphan provides effective cough relief without the respiratory depression or dependence risk associated with opioid antitussives at recommended doses.
  • Sugar-Free Formulation: Suitable for patients with Diabetes Mellitus and those who need to limit sugar intake.

Side Effects of Solocof D Syrup Sugar Free 100ml

When taken as directed, Solocof D Syrup Sugar Free 100ml is generally well tolerated. Side effects, if they occur, are usually mild and temporary.

Common Side Effects
  • Dry Mouth: A common antihistamine effect
  • Dizziness: Light-headedness may be in some individuals.
  • Nausea or Stomach Upset: Mild gastric discomfort can occur.
  • Drowsiness or Sedation: Due to Chlorpheniramine; may affect alertness.
Uncommon Side Effects
  • Elevated blood pressure: Due to Phenylephrine
  • Skin Rash or Allergic Reactions: Such as itching or urticaria
  • Restlessness or Insomnia: Especially with Phenylephrine
Serious Side Effects (Require Immediate Medical Attention):
  • Respiratory depression: though uncommon at therapeutic doses, may occur in overdose or in very young children.
  • Severe Allergic Reaction: Difficulty breathing, swelling of face/lips/throat
  • Severe Drowsiness or Confusion: Especially in elderly patients
  • Severe Palpitations or Chest Pain: With dizziness or fainting
  • Persistent Vomiting or Severe Abdominal Pain

Directions for Use

  • Solocof D Syrup Sugar Free 100ml is commonly available as a liquid syrup. It should be measured using a dosing cup or spoon for accurate dosing.
  • This medication should be taken exactly as prescribed by your physician. It is usually taken every 4–6 hours as needed. You should not exceed 4 doses in 24 hours. Do not exceed the recommended dose, especially in children.
  • Do not change the dose or frequency on your own. Always follow medical advice.

How it works

  • Chlorpheniramine is a first-generation antihistamine that blocks histamine H1 receptors. Histamine is a key mediator in allergic reactions, responsible for symptoms such as sneezing, watery eyes, and itching. By preventing histamine from binding to its receptors, chlorpheniramine effectively relieves these allergy-related symptoms. Because of its ability to cross the blood–brain barrier, it may also produce mild sedation, which is commonly observed in patients.
  • Phenylephrine is a sympathomimetic agent that acts as an α1-adrenergic receptor agonist. Its primary action is vasoconstriction of blood vessels in the nasal mucosa. This reduces swelling and mucus secretion, thereby relieving nasal congestion.
  • Dextromethorphan: A cough suppressant that works on the cough center in the brain. It reduces the urge to cough, making cough less frequent and less severe, while normal breathing remains unaffected. It is non-opioid and generally safe when used at recommended doses, but high doses can be harmful.

Together, these ingredients provide rapid relief from multiple symptoms, making it effective for short-term management of colds, flu, and allergies.

Quick Tips for Solocof D Syrup Sugar Free 100ml

  • Complete the full course as prescribed.
  • Do Not Exceed the Recommended Dose: Taking more than prescribed, especially Dextromethorphan, may cause serious brain effects like dissociation and poor coordination. Always follow your doctor’s advice.
  • Supportive Care for Nasal Congestion: Drinking warm fluids like hot water and inhaling steam may help loosen mucus and relieve nasal congestion, making breathing easier.
  • Inform Your Doctor of All Medicines: Always share your complete medication list with your healthcare provider before starting treatment.
  • Check Other Labels: Many "over-the-counter" cold medicines contain these same ingredients. Check labels to avoid an accidental overdose.

Drug-Food Interaction

  • Food (Generally Safe): Solocof D Syrup Sugar Free 100ml may be taken with or without food. Taking it with food may reduce the risk of gastric discomfort.
  • Alcohol: Significantly increases drowsiness and the risk of accidents.
  • Caffeine (e.g., coffee, tea): May reduce the sedative effect of the antihistamine but could increase the risk of heart palpitations from the decongestant.

Interactions with Other Drugs

  • MAO Inhibitors (Severe): Taking these together can cause a life-threatening "hypertensive crisis" (extreme BP spike).
  • Antidepressants (CAUTION):Tricyclic antidepressants can increase the side effects of Chlorpheniramine.
  • Other Antihistamines or Sedatives (Moderate): Combined use with other sedating antihistamines, benzodiazepines, or CNS depressants may increase drowsiness and impair alertness.
  • Antihypertensive Medicines (Moderate): Phenylephrine may reduce the effectiveness of blood pressure-lowering medications. Use under medical supervision.

Drug-Disease Interactions

  • Hypertension or Cardiovascular Disease (High Risk): Phenylephrine may increase blood pressure and heart rate. Use with caution and under medical supervision.
  • Hepatic Impairment (Moderate): Dextromethorphan is metabolized in the liver; impaired function may increase drug levels
  • Diabetes Mellitus (Low Risk):This sugar-free formulation is suitable for patients with diabetes. However, patients should still consult their doctor for appropriate use.
  • Narrow-Angle Glaucoma: May dangerously increase eye pressure.
  • Benign Prostatic Hyperplasia (Moderate): Chlorpheniramine may cause urinary retention, especially in elderly patients.

Overdose

Always follow the prescribed dose. Taking more than recommended of this medicine may cause symptoms such as excessive drowsiness, dizziness, palpitations, restlessness, or stomach discomfort. In rare cases, changes in heart rate or confusion may occur. If an overdose is suspected, seek medical attention promptly.

What If You Forget to take Solocof D Syrup Sugar Free 100ml?

Since Solocof D Syrup Sugar Free 100ml is typically taken as prescribed by a doctor, a missed dose is usually not critical. If taken on a schedule, take the missed dose as soon as you remember, unless the next dose is due within 2 hours, then you can skip it. Never double the dose.

Fact Box

Therapeutic Class

Symptomatic relief of dry cough, cold, and allergic upper respiratory conditions.

Action Class

Antihistamine (H1 blocker) + Antitussive + Sympathomimetic (Decongestant)

Chemical Class

Alkylamine derivative (Chlorpheniramine) + Morphinan derivative (Dextromethorphan) + Phenylethanolamine derivative (Phenylephrine)

Habit Forming

No
